body {

	font-family: Verdana, Arial, Helvetica, sans-serif;

	color:#FFFFFF;

	background:#a7a7a7 url(../images/bg.jpg) repeat-x top;

	font-size: 12px;

	margin-top:0px;

	margin-bottom:0px;

	



}



#main {

	width:760px;

	border-left: 2px solid #666666;

	border-right: 2px solid #666666;

}







#main #header .header_top {

	background-image: url(../images/domus_del_chirurgo.jpg);

	height: 70px;

	width: 760px;

}

#main #header .header_center {

	background-image: url(../images/domus.jpg);

	height: 57px;

	width: 760px;

}

#main #header .header_bottom {

	background-image: url(../images/domus_rimini.jpg);

	height: 170px;

	width: 760px;

}



#main #content .content_left {

	background-image: url(../images/sfondo_domus_rimini.jpg);

	width: 522px;

	height: 695px;

	background-color: #000000;

	background-repeat: no-repeat;

	padding: 20px;

	text-align:justify;
	
	color:#CCCCCC;

}



#main #content .content_right .menu a, a:visited {

	font-family: Verdana, Arial, Helvetica, sans-serif;

	color: #FFFFFF;

	text-decoration: none;

}

#main #content .content_left .hr {

	border-top-width: 1px;

	border-top-style: solid;

	border-top-color: #999999;

	margin-top:0px;

}





#main #content .content_right .menu a:hover, a:active {

	font-family: Verdana, Arial, Helvetica, sans-serif;

	color: #890909;

	text-decoration: none;

}





#main #content .content_right {

	background-color: #2a2a2a;

	background-image: url(../images/destra_domus.jpg);

	background-repeat: no-repeat;

	width: 198px;

	height: 695px;

}



.menu {

border-bottom:#CCCCCC thin solid;

padding-top:10px;

padding-bottom:10px;

}



.title {

font-size:18px;

}



.center {

text-align:center;



}



.footer{

width:760px;

height:51px;

background:url(../images/footer_domus.jpg) no-repeat;

}



.left {

text-align:left;

padding-left: 48px;



}



.left_2 {

text-align:left;

padding-left: 15px;

padding-top: 10px;



}



h1 {

margin:0px;

font-family:"Times New Roman", Times, serif;

}



h2 {

margin:0px;

font-family:Verdana, Arial, Helvetica, sans-serif;

color:#FFFFFF;

}



.right {

text-align:right;

padding-top:25px;

padding-right: 15px;

}

.img_left {

border:#cccccc solid 2px;

padding: 1px; 

float:left;

margin-right:10px; 

margin-top:5px;

}

.img_right {

border:#cccccc solid 2px;

padding: 1px; 

float:right;

margin-left:10px; 

margin-top:5px;

}



